Learning Objective

Students will be able to distinguish between renewable and nonrenewable resources.

Description

Looking for a visual way to teach your students about renewable and nonrenewable resources? These sort cards allow students to distinguish between the two. This now contains two complete sets of sort cards (both small and large). These sort cards are hands-on and keep your students engaged. Perfect for interactive notebooks, guided practice, or assessment!

This contains:

  • Two sets of small sort cards for renewable and nonrenewable resources
  • Two sets of large sort cards for renewable and nonrenewable resources
  • Pocket pattern that can be used in interactive notebooks
  • Picture of sort cards in interactive notebooks
  • Answer Key
